Future Farmers
Future Farmers of America from Pawnee City visit Lincoln to learn about their State's unique unicameral (i.e., one-house) legislature. In actuality, a relatively small percentage of the Nebraska's workforce work as full-time farmers. The average age of Nebraska farmers rises every year as fewer young people have a desire to carry on the family tradition.

Old Market
Omaha's bustling Old Market district just South of downtown. Nebraska's diverse economy has traditionally cushioned the blow of recessions. In the current recession, Nebraska is the only State that has seen a decrease in unemployment.
